Mislim da ovo ne bi trebalo bas biti unutat "Pocetnickih pitaja" ali nisam ni nasao neko bolje mjest, a mozda ipak i je poceticko pitanje.
Prebacio sam jedan fajl sa PHP kodm na server(ispravio sam neki bug) nacin na koji sam to ucio za taj isti fajl(vec sam na 20v verziji) sigurno kojih i 30 puti, te naravno bacim odmah pogled na web stranicu da li radi kada ono ne radi javlja da nepostoji neka fukcija i kada gledam ja zbunjeno u to i mislim se meni lokalno radi ????
Nakon 15 minuti trazenja problema otkrijem sljedece:
1. Transfer se radio u ASCI modu(ovako se radilo i prije i prije nikada nije bio ovaj problem) i zbo toga se jedn NEWLINE nestao:
ovo je fajl koji saljem(dio fajla radi jednostavnosti):
PHP kôd:
// Fnkcija u $text, doda $add ali prije toga stavi $prefix,
// te unutar $add doda slasheve(\) i NewLIne zamjeni u " "(SPACE)
function addIfNotEmpty( $text, $add, $prefix)
{
a ovo je sto je stiglo na server:
PHP kôd:
// Fnkcija u $text, doda $add ali prije toga stavi $prefix,
// te unutar $add doda slasheve(\) i NewLIne zamjeni u " "(SPACE) function addIfNotEmpty( $text, $add, $prefix)
{
Da li netko zan zasto se to dogodio ?
Ja sam rijestio to tako sto sam ga prebacio u BINARNOM modu, ali me stvarno zanima zbog cega se to dogodilo.
Jer stvarno ne kuzim, sve sam uradio kao i prije za isti faj i to prko 30 puti kao i do sada a sada od jednom neka greska ???
Koristio sam FileZilu na Ubuntu 7.10(nisam pokusavao sa drugim alatima)
Od sada sve prebacujem samo u BINARNOM modu i ovaj ASCI mod bi tribalo zabraniti.
A da nesto na serveru koje sam salo nije zabrljano ???